**System Information**
Operating system: Windows-10-10.0.19044-SP0 64 Bits
Graphics card: NVIDIA GeForce RTX 2080 Ti/PCIe/SSE2 NVIDIA Corporation 4.5.0 NVIDIA 516.59
**Blender Version**
Broken: version: 3.3.0, branch: master, commit date: 2022-09-06 15:39, hash: `rB0759f671ce1f`
Worked: (newest version of Blender that worked as expected)
**Short description of error**
When in camera-view and hitting Numpad Dash to get into local view of selected object, the 3D-Viewport ALWAYS goes into perspective mode needlessly. **Auto-perspective is turned off.**
**Exact steps for others to reproduce the error**
Open .blend file.
Cube is already selected.
Camera-view **(Numpad 0**) is also already selected{F13617451}.
Hit **Numpad Dash** to go to local view of selected Cube.
**3D-Viewport is now in perspective mode.**
**To further add to the unnecessary switch of view-mode:**
While in perspective local view of the cube as described above, hit **Numpad 5** to switch to orthographic view.
Now tab** Numpad 0** to go back to camera-view.
Hit **Numpad Dash** again to go to local-view of the cube again.
Once again, you are needlessly in perspective mode.
